Activity type Activity value Assay description Source Reference
ED50 (functional) = 2.3 mg kg-1 In vivo efficacy as ED50 against E. coli HM-42 by oral administration in mice. ChEMBL. 7707323
ED50 (functional) = 2.3 mg kg-1 In vivo efficacy as ED50 against E. coli HM-42 by oral administration in mice. ChEMBL. 7707323
ED50 (functional) = 10 mg kg-1 In vivo efficacy as ED50 against S. aureus HS-93 by oral administration in mice. ChEMBL. 7707323
ED50 (functional) = 61 mg kg-1 In vivo efficacy as ED50 against Pseudomonas aeruginosa HS-116 by oral administration in mice. ChEMBL. 7707323
MIC (functional) = 0.06 ug ml-1 In vitro antibacterial activity measured as minimum inhibitory concentration was evaluated on Bacillus subtilis ATCC 6633(Bs). ChEMBL. 7707323
MIC (functional) = 0.06 ug ml-1 In vitro antibacterial activity measured as minimum inhibitory concentration was evaluated on klebsiella pneumoniae ATCC 10031 (Kp). ChEMBL. 7707323
MIC (functional) = 0.06 ug ml-1 In vitro antibacterial activity measured as minimum inhibitory concentration, was evaluated on Escherichia coli ATCC 23559(Ec). ChEMBL. 7707323
MIC (functional) = 0.06 ug ml-1 In vitro antibacterial activity measured as minimum inhibitory concentration, was evaluated on Enterobacter cloacae ATCC 23355 (Ecl). ChEMBL. 7707323
MIC (functional) = 0.06 ug ml-1 In vitro antibacterial activity measured as minimum inhibitory concentration, was evaluated on Escherichia coli ATCC 23559(Ec). ChEMBL. 7707323
MIC (functional) = 0.12 ug ml-1 In vitro antibacterial activity measured as minimum inhibitory concentration was evaluated on Bacillus cereus ATCC 11778 (Bc). ChEMBL. 7707323
MIC (functional) = 0.12 ug ml-1 In vitro antibacterial activity measured as minimum inhibitory concentration was evaluated on Staphylococcus aureus ATCC 25178 (Sa). ChEMBL. 7707323
MIC (functional) = 0.12 ug ml-1 In vitro antibacterial activity measured as minimum inhibitory concentration was evaluated on Staphylococcus epidermidis ATCC 155-1 (Se). ChEMBL. 7707323
MIC (functional) = 0.12 ug ml-1 In vitro antibacterial activity measured as minimum inhibitory concentration was evaluated on morganella morganii ATCC 8019 (Mm). ChEMBL. 7707323
MIC (functional) = 0.5 ug ml-1 In vitro antibacterial activity measured as minimum inhibitory concentration was evaluated on proteus vulgaris ATCC 8427 (Pv). ChEMBL. 7707323
MIC (functional) = 1 ug ml-1 In vitro antibacterial activity measured as minimum inhibitory concentration was evaluated on Streptococcus faecalis ATCC10541 (Sf). ChEMBL. 7707323
MIC (functional) = 1 ug ml-1 In vitro antibacterial activity measured as minimum inhibitory concentration was evaluated on Pseudomonas aeruginosa ATCC 10145 (Pa). ChEMBL. 7707323

We have no records of whole-cell/tissue assays done with this compound What does this mean?

Many chemical entities in TDR Targets come from high-throughput screenings with whole cells or tissue samples, and not all assayed compounds have been tested against a single a single target protein, probably because they get ruled out during screening process. Even if these compounds may have not been of interest in the original screening, they may come as interesting leads for other screening assays. Furthermore, we may be able to propose drug-target associations using chemical similarities and network patterns.
